html5靠右
在HTML5中,我们可以通过CSS样式来实现元素的靠左和靠右对齐,本文将详细介绍如何使用HTML5和CSS实现这两种布局效果。
(图片来源网络,侵删)
我们需要了解HTML5的基本结构,一个简单的HTML5文档结构如下:
<!DOCTYPE html> <html lang="zh"> <head> <meta charset="UTF8"> <meta name="viewport" content="width=devicewidth, initialscale=1.0"> <title>Document</title> <link rel="stylesheet" href="styles.css"> </head> <body> <div class="container"> <div class="item itemleft">左边的内容</div> <div class="item itemright">右边的内容</div> </div> </body> </html>
接下来,我们将学习如何使用CSS来设置元素的文本对齐方式,在CSS中,我们可以使用textalign
属性来设置文本的对齐方式。textalign
属性有以下几个值:
1、left
:将文本左对齐。
2、right
:将文本右对齐。
3、center
:将文本居中对齐。
4、justify
:将文本两端对齐。
5、start
:将文本开始位置对齐(仅适用于行内元素)。
6、end
:将文本结束位置对齐(仅适用于行内元素)。
7、normal
:默认值,文本按照其字体的自然流动方向对齐。
8、nowrap
:禁止文本换行。
9、inherit
:继承父元素的textalign
属性值。
下面我们通过实例来演示如何使用这些值来实现元素的靠左和靠右对齐。
1、靠左对齐:
将.item
类的textalign
属性设置为left
,即可实现靠左对齐,代码如下:
.item { textalign: left; }
示例:
<!DOCTYPE html> <html lang="zh"> <head> <meta charset="UTF8"> <meta name="viewport" content="width=devicewidth, initialscale=1.0"> <title>Document</title> <link rel="stylesheet" href="styles.css"> </head> <body> <div class="container"> <div class="item itemleft">左边的内容</div> <div class="item itemright">右边的内容</div> </div> </body> </html>
2、靠右对齐:
将.item
类的textalign
属性设置为right
,即可实现靠右对齐,代码如下:
.item { textalign: right; }
示例:
<!DOCTYPE html> <html lang="zh"> <head> <meta charset="UTF8"> <meta name="viewport" content="width=devicewidth, initialscale=1.0"> <title>Document</title> <link rel="stylesheet" href="styles.css"> </head> <body> <div class="container"> <div class="item itemleft">左边的内容</div> <div class="item itemright">右边的内容</div> </div> </body> </html>